    M372A - Overview

    Why use the Studio Technologies MODEL 372A ? Having one talk and two listen channels may seem unconventional. But it can be ideal for many "real-world" applications. Often an intercom user is primarily listening and non-verbally responding to requests made by producers, directors, or stage managers. Typically, the Model 372A will be configured to be part of one talk-and-listen party-line intercom channel. During the time that an event is taking place the listen function will serve a much more important role; the talk function will rarely be utilized. However, the second listen channel will often be important. Typically, it will be designated as a program-listen or "show audio" channel. The two listen channels, along with the ability to receive and display call signals, allow the Model 372A to very effectively support production personnel in a compact and cost-effective manner.

    Only a single Power-over-Ethernet (PoE) connection is required for operation. Key user features can be easily configured using the STcontroller software application. Configurable parameters include electret microphone powering, microphone preamplifier gain, talk button operation, and headphone channel assignment. Features include integrated sidetone, call signal receive display, and remote mic kill ("talk off"). The range of capabilities, along with the excellent audio quality provided by the digital audio signal path, offers a unique and powerful user experience.

    Setting up and configuring a Model 372A is simple. An etherCONr RJ45 receptacle is used to interconnect with a standard twisted-pair Ethernet port associated with a local-area network (LAN). This connection provides both power and bidirectional digital audio. The Model 372A is compatible with both broadcast and "gaming" headsets.

    A broadcast or intercom-style headset with a dynamic or electret (DC-powered) microphone can be interfaced with the Model 372A using a 5-pin XLR connector. The Model 372A also directly supports connection of earbuds or gaming headsets that utilize a 3.5 mm 4-conductor TRRS plug. These moderately priced devices, commonly associated with mobile phones or personal computers, are often of high-quality and may be preferred for some applications. With the Model 372A's moderate price and ability to support a broad range of headset devices the overall cost of deploying an intercom system can often meet budget goals

    • Specifications:

      • Power Source:
      • Power-over-Ethernet (PoE): class 1 (very low power, =3.84 watts) per IEEEr 802.3af

        Network Audio Technology:
      • Type: Dante audio-over-Ethernet
      • AES67-2013 Support: yes
      • Dante Domain Manager (DDM) Support: yes
      • Bit Depth: up to 24
      • Sample Rate: 48 kHz
      • Number of Transmitter (Output) Channels: 1
      • Number of Receiver (Input) Channels: 2
      • Dante Audio Flows: 4; 2 transmitter, 2 receiver

        Network Interface:
      • Type: 100BASE-TX, twisted-pair Ethernet, Power-over-Ethernet (PoE)
        supported Data Rate: 100 Mb/s (10 Mb/s and 1000 Mb/s "GigE" Ethernet not supported) Compatibility - Headset A: monaural single- or
        dual-ear broadcast-style with dynamic or electret (low-voltage DC- powered) microphone: pin 1 mic -/shield/screen; pin 2 mic +; pin 3
        phones -; pin 4 phones +
      • Compatibility - Headset B: CTIA™/AHJ configuration (typically uses electret powered mic): tip
        phones left; ring 1 phones right; ring 2 common; sleeve mic
      • Audio Channels: 1 talk, 2 listen

        Microphone Input:
      • Compatibility: dynamic or electret (low-voltage DC-powered) microphones
      • Type: unbalanced
      • Electret Microphone Power: 3.3 volts DC via 2.00 k resistor, selectable on/off
      • Impedance: 1 k ohms, nominal, microphone power off; 690 ohms, nominal, microphone power on
      • Gain: 24, 30, 36, 42, or 48 dB, selectable, ref. -60 dBu input to Dante output (-20 dBFS nominal)
      • Frequency Response: 40 Hz to 20 kHz, -3 dB
      • Distortion (THD+N): <0.02% (at minimum gain)
      • Dynamic Range: 91 dB of dynamic range

        Compressor:
      • Application: applies to Dante transmitter (output) channel and sidetone audio
      • Threshold: 2 dB above nominal level (-19 dBFS)
      • Slope: 2:1
      • Status LED: compressor active

        Headphone Output:
      • Type: 2-channel
      • Compatibility: intended for connection to stereo (dual-channel) or monaural (single-channel) headsets
        with nominal impedance of 50 ohms or greater
      • Maximum Output Voltage: 2.8 Vrms, 1 kHz, 150 ohm load
      • Frequency Response: 20 Hz to 10 kHz, -3 dB
      • Distortion (THD+N): <0.002%
      • Dynamic Range: >100 dB

        Call Receive Function:
      • Implementation: monitors both Dante receiver (input) channels for presence of call signals
      • Signaling Method: 20 kHz, ±800 Hz, within audio channels
      • Call Receive Level: -27 dBFS minimum

        Connectors:
      • Headset A: 5-pin female XLR
      • Headset B: 4-conductor (TRRS) 3.5 mm jack, per Japanese standard JEITA/EIAJ RC-5325A
      • Ethernet: Neutrik NE8FBH etherCON RJ45 receptacle
      • USB: type A receptacle (located inside Model 373A's enclosure and used only for application firmware
        updates)

        Configuration: requires Studio Technologies' STcontroller software application,
        version 2.01.00 and later

        Environmental:
      • Operating Temperature: 0 to 50 degrees C (32 to 122 degrees F)
      • Storage Temperature: -40 to 70 degrees C (-40 to 158 degrees F)
      • Humidity: 0 to 95%, non-condensing
      • Altitude: not characterized
